Cassette Cooling Systems: A Smart, Space-Saving Cooling SolutionWhen it comes to cooling large, open-plan spaces or contemporary commercial buildings, cassette air conditioning units are a progressively popular option. Streamlined, discreet, and extremely efficient, they use powerful climate control without jeopardizing on aesthetics.But just what are cassette air conditioning system-- and why are many businesses and property owners picking them?What Is a Cassette Cooling Unit?A cassette a/c unit is a type of split system ac system, generally mounted in a suspended or false ceiling. Unlike wall-mounted systems, cassette units disperse cool (or warm) air in 4 instructions, offering even temperature control throughout the room (air conditioner service perth).They consist of 2 main parts: Indoor Unit: The cassette, set up flush with the ceiling.Outdoor Unit: Normally put on the building's exterior.This setup is perfect for rooms without readily available wall area or where visual appeals are a priority.Key Benefits of Cassette A/c Units
Where Are Cassette AC Units Most Frequently Used?Open- plan officesRetail shops and showroomsRestaurants and cafesHotels and lobbiesSchools and universitiesModern residential apartments with drop ceilingsThey're particularly favored in commercial fit-outs and renovations, where space and appearance are top priorities.Installation ConsiderationsWhile cassette a/c systems are flexible, they do need: Ceiling area for the indoor system (normally 300mm or more clearance) Access for maintenance through a ceiling panel or gain access to hatch.Professional installation, particularly for electrical wiring and refrigerant handling.A certified heating and cooling technician will ensure the system is properly sized, appropriately put, and safely linked to drain and power systems.Maintenance Tips for Cassette UnitsTo keep your cassette air conditioning working effectively: Tidy or change the filters every 1-- 3 months.Check for clogs in the condensate drain.Schedule an expert inspection a minimum of as soon as a year.Make sure the vents are unblocked for smooth airflow.Regular servicing not only improves efficiency however likewise extends the life of the unit (air conditioner service perth).Are Cassette Units Right for You?If you're trying to find a cooling solution that: Does not clutter your wallsCools evenly in big or open roomsBlends seamlessly with your interior decoration . then cassette a/c unit deserve considering - air conditioner service perth.They're specifically suited for industrial properties, hospitality places, and high-end renovations.Final Words: Why Select Cassette AC Units?Cassette a/c systems provide an effective mix of efficiency, design, and effectiveness.
